Internal Memo — Reseller Programme Update. Sales leads: the Ardenfold reseller programme completes its first full quarter with 22 active partners, ahead of the 15 targeted. Margins to partners hold at the agreed 18%; no exceptions have been granted and none should be offered. Two partners in the Westholm territory are under review for channel conflict. Updated partner tiers take effect next month. Background relevant to where this programme heads next is set out below.

management briefing: Headcount on the Quenael team goes from 9 to 80 by the end of July. Gross margin on Quenael came in at 15 percent against a plan of 20 percent.

Murmurline environments — log sampling notes for review. Murmurline is our chattiest service, and each environment applies a different sampling policy: dev logs everything, staging samples INFO at 10%, and prod samples INFO at 1% with full retention of WARN and above. Reviewers should check that any new log line respects these tiers and avoids per-request DEBUG in hot paths. The prod sampler is initialized from the configuration values reproduced below.

settings of tagef-bawif:
DRUIX_HOST=druix.zemvarlabs.internal
DRUIX_PORT=8000

Subject: Handover — validator plugin stuff

Hey Priya,

Passing you the baton on Checkwright, our plugin system for data validators. The new schema-drift plugin shipped Tuesday and mostly behaves, but it occasionally flags empty CSV uploads as "malformed" — harmless, just noisy. I've muted the alert until Friday. If support escalates anything about plugin load failures, the fix is usually bumping the registry cache. Questions after I'm off? Reach the Checkwright maintainers at the address below.

billing contact of hawip-kahif = zorwyn@tolvaqlabs.corp

Subject: DR drill notes — Queuelet compaction

For future maintainers: during today's drill we verified that Queuelet's log compaction resumes correctly after a region failover. Compaction checkpoints replicate with ~30s lag; anything newer is recompacted on the standby, which is safe but slow. If the checkpoint store itself is lost, restore it from the sealed backup, which decrypts with the passphrase below.

vault phrase of bagaf-kajeg = jorath-feniel-briir-siliel-ralix